Papers of Joseph Needham as a historian of Chinese science, technology and medicine
| Title |
Documents relating to the work of Dr. C. Chan Gunn of the Workers' Compensation Board of British Columbia, Canada, on the effects of therapeutic acupuncture in various chronic diseases |
| Reference |
SCC2/290/63 |
| Creator |
Gunn, C. Chan; Needham, Joseph; Blakemore, Colin; |
| Covering Dates |
27 July 1978–4 Jan. 1980 |
| Extent and Medium |
12 sheets; Paper |
|
| Content and context |
The documents comprise a letter from Gunn, originally accompanying a copy of a report on his work, and asking for advice on whether the material would be acccepted for an M.D. degree at Cambridge; copy of a letter from Joseph Needham to Colin Blakemore of the Institute of Physiology and Psychology, University of Cambridge, asking for his advice on the suitability of Gunn's work for an M.D. degree; two letters from Blakemore to Needham, commenting on Gunn's thesis; copy of a letter from Needham to Gunn, commenting on his work; 3 further letters from Gunn to Needham; copy of a further letter from Needham to Gunn. |
